Slow pyrolysis of willow (Salix) studied with GC/MS and GC/FTIR/FID

Abstract :
Small samples (15–150 mg) of wood and bark from basket willow (Salix viminalis) clone Jorr were pyrolysed at 550°C. Samples from pure wood of European White (Silver) Birch (Betula pendula (alba)) and Norway Spruce (Picea abies) were used as references. The compounds produced during pyrolysis were analysed using gas chromatographic (GC) methods: direct injection with GC/FTIR/FID, direct injection with GC/MS, and pre-concentration with GC/MS. The samples from salix, birch and spruce all produced a range of low molecular weight compounds: aliphatic acids, esters, aldehydes, and ketones as well as furans. Commonly, these samples also formed aromatic compounds: phenol, methyl-phenols, and the guiacol (2-Methoxyphenol) series of compounds. Salix and birch both produced the syringol (2,6-Dimethoxyphenol) series of compounds. Syringol derivatives were not detected from the pyrolysis of spruce.
